详细介绍一下MVC架构和C3P0数据库连接池,以及前端jQuery、AJAX等技术
时间: 2023-05-25 08:05:49 浏览: 151
MVC架构:
MVC(Model-View-Controller)是一种软件设计模式,可将应用程序分为三个核心组件:模型(Model)负责处理数据,视图(View)负责展示数据,控制器(Controller)负责协调模型和视图之间的交互。MVC架构的优点是能够将应用程序分离为几个部分,使得应用程序更易于维护,同时还能提高应用程序的可扩展性和可重用性。
C3P0数据库连接池:
C3P0是一个Java应用程序的数据库连接池库,它通过管理数据库连接实现了对数据库资源的有效利用,有效地减轻了数据库服务器的压力。C3P0除了提供连接池的基本功能外,还提供了许多高级特性,例如自动检测失效的连接并关闭、自动检测长时间未使用的连接并关闭等。
前端jQuery、AJAX等技术:
jQuery是一种JavaScript库,它简化了HTML文档遍历和操作以及事件处理等操作,是一种快速、小巧、功能丰富的JavaScript库。
AJAX(Asynchronous JavaScript and XML)是一种用于创建交互式Web应用程序的Web开发技术,通过在后台异步地发送HTTP请求,AJAX可以更新部分Web页面,而不需要刷新整个页面。
这些技术可以帮助开发人员有效地处理前端交互,以实现更好的用户体验和更高的应用程序性能。
阅读全文